Job Description
Job Overview:
My client is looking for a highly skilled and experienced Data Architect to join their consulting team. As a Data Architect, you will work closely with clients to design and implement tailored data solutions that meet their business requirements. The role requires a strong foundation in data management, architecture design, and integration, with an ability to create scalable and efficient data systems for a variety of industries. You will collaborate with client teams, stakeholders, and internal resources to ensure the successful delivery of data-driven strategies, ensuring that clients can make informed decisions based on high-quality, accessible data.
Key Responsibilities:
Client-Focused Data Architecture Solutions:
- Engage with clients to understand their business needs and challenges, and translate them into customized data architecture solutions.
- Design scalable, high-performance data models and architectures, including data lakes, data warehouses, and real-time data streaming solutions.
- Implement and optimize data architectures to enable data-driven decision-making and business intelligence across client organizations.
Data Integration and Management:
- Lead the design and implementation of data integration strategies, ensuring seamless connectivity across disparate systems, applications, and cloud platforms.
- Architect ETL (Extract, Transform, Load) pipelines that ensure high-quality and accurate data is delivered to clients in a timely manner.
- Advise clients on data storage, management practices, and integration tools that are best suited for their business objectives.
Advisory and Best Practices:
- Provide expert advisory services on data governance, data quality, and data security best practices.
- Recommend industry best practices for data modeling, database management, and data lifecycle management tailored to client needs.
- Guide clients through the implementation of cloud-based data solutions (e.g., AWS, Azure, Google Cloud) and emerging technologies such as AI and machine learning integration.
Collaboration with Cross-Functional Teams:
- Work collaboratively with client teams, including data scientists, business analysts, software engineers, and leadership to define and deliver data architecture solutions.
- Translate technical jargon into clear, understandable insights and communicate solutions to non-technical stakeholders.
- Assist clients in defining data governance frameworks, security protocols, and compliance with regulations (e.g., GDPR, CCPA).
Project Leadership and Management:
- Lead data architecture projects from conceptualization to implementation, ensuring timelines, budgets, and scope are adhered to.
- Provide guidance and mentorship to junior consultants, analysts, and technical staff working on client projects.
- Develop detailed documentation, reports, and presentations to share project progress, findings, and recommendations with clients and internal stakeholders.
Continuous Improvement and Innovation:
- Stay up to date with the latest trends, tools, and technologies in data architecture, data engineering, and data management.
- Propose and implement innovative solutions that improve data architecture efficiency, scalability, and flexibility for clients.
- Participate in knowledge-sharing sessions, contributing to the development of internal best practices and methodologies for data architecture projects.
Qualifications:
- Bachelor’s degree in Computer Science, Information Technology, Data Science, or a related field.
- years of experience as a Data Architect, Data Engineer, or in a similar consulting or client-facing role.
- Strong expertise in designing and implementing data architectures, data models, and integration solutions for complex business needs.
- Hands-on experience with databases (SQL and NoSQL), data warehousing, data lakes, and cloud technologies (AWS, Azure, Google Cloud).
- In-depth knowledge of data integration tools, ETL/ELT processes, and data pipelines.
- Proven ability to work closely with clients, understand their business challenges, and translate those into actionable data strategies.
- Experience with data governance, data quality management, and compliance frameworks.
- Familiarity with big data technologies (e.g., Hadoop, Spark) and data visualization tools (e.g., Tableau, Power BI) is a plus.
- Excellent communication skills, both verbal and written, with the ability to present complex concepts to non-technical stakeholders.
Preferred Qualifications:
- Master’s degree in Computer Science, Data Science, or a related field.
- Certifications in cloud platforms (e.g., AWS Certified Solutions Architect, Google Cloud Professional Data Engineer).
- Previous experience in a consulting environment, working with multiple clients across diverse industries.
- Knowledge of machine learning models and their integration into data solutions.
- Familiarity with modern data architecture frameworks such as microservices and serverless computing.
Physical Requirements:
- Ability to work in an office or remote environment as required.
- Some travel may be necessary for client meetings and project engagements.
Salt is acting as an Employment Agency in relation to this vacancy.
Job Information
Job Reference: JO-2501-349687Salary: NegotiableSalary per: annumJob Duration: Job Start Date: 03/03/2025Job Industries: Project & Programme ManagementJob Locations: Saudi ArabiaJob Types: Permanent
Apply for this Job
Name *
Please enter your full name.
Email *
Enter a valid email address.
Upload a CV *
Upload your CV to accompany your application for this job.
Please tick this box to consent to us using your data. How we use your data is outlined in our privacy policy *
Fields marked with * are required.